Overview
Coursera Flash Sale
40% Off Coursera Plus for 3 Months!
Grab it
Explore practical applications of data structures and algorithms in real-world software development through this 11-minute educational video. Discover how fundamental DSA concepts are implemented across various domains including maps for location services, decision-making algorithms, caching mechanisms for performance optimization, search suggestion systems, finding extreme values in datasets, classification algorithms, dependency resolution in software packages, efficient data retrieval methods, membership testing operations, and cryptographic applications. Learn to bridge the gap between theoretical computer science concepts and their practical implementations in modern technology systems, gaining insights into how these foundational programming concepts power everyday applications and services.
Syllabus
00:00 - Intro
02:58 - Maps
03:44 - Decision Making
04:12 - Caching
04:42 - Search Suggestions
05:06 - Highest and Lowest Values
06:11 - Classification
06:55 - Dependency Resolution
07:48 - Data Retrieval
08:14 - Membership testing
09:45 - Cryptography
Taught by
Caleb Curry